Mission

The elyria public library system will always offer free resources with unlimited possibilities for every person in the community it serves. Library resources in all formats will be readily and equitably accessible to all library users. The library provides free access to all library materials, services, and programs. The library provides lifelong learning services to all. The library upholds the principles of intellectual freedom and resists all efforts to censor resources. The library's employees are professional, friendly, efficient, and qualified personnel. The library provides the highest level of service to all library users. The library will monitor library services to ensure that they respond in a relevant way to changing needs and demands, and that their quality is as high as resources allow. The library is committed to patron confidentiality. The library practices fiscally responsible management of public resources with full accountability.
